Matthew 6:14-26
New American Standard Bible
Chapter 6
14For if you forgive other people for their offenses, your heavenly Father will also forgive you. 15But if you do not forgive other people, then your Father will not forgive your offenses.
16Now whenever you fast, do not make a gloomy face as the hypocrites do, for they distort their faces so that they will be noticed by people when they are fasting. Truly I say to you, they have their reward in full.
17But as for you, when you fast, anoint your head and wash your face,
18so that your fasting will not be noticed by people but by your Father who is in secret; and your Father who sees what is done in secret will reward you.
19Do not store up for yourselves treasures on earth, where moth and rust destroy, and where thieves break in and steal.
20But store up for yourselves treasures in heaven, where neither moth nor rust destroys, and where thieves do not break in or steal;
21for where your treasure is, there your heart will be also.
22The eye is the lamp of the body; so then, if your eye is clear, your whole body will be full of light.
23But if your eye is bad, your whole body will be full of darkness. So if the light that is in you is darkness, how great is the darkness!
25For this reason I say to you, do not be worried about your life, as to what you will eat or what you will drink; nor for your body, as to what you will put on. Is life not more than food, and the body more than clothing?
26Look at the birds of the sky, that they do not sow, nor reap, nor gather crops into barns, and yet your heavenly Father feeds them. Are you not much more important than they?
